Description

In a deeply reflective narrative, the Book of Hosea explores themes of love, redemption, and divine mercy. The author, cloaked in anonymity, delves into the tumultuous relationship between God and His people, using vivid imagery and heartfelt metaphor to illustrate the complexities of faith and betrayal. The poignant verses reveal the struggles of a prophet tasked with conveying a divine message amidst a backdrop of disobedience and moral decay.

As readers journey through Hosea's prophetic calls for repentance, they are invited to consider the consequences of a strayed heart and the unwavering nature of divine love. This timeless piece of scripture compels believers to reflect on their own spiritual journeys, challenging them to seek reconciliation and understanding in their relationship with the divine.
